Chief Minister Vijay inaugurates MLA office in Perambur

Tamil Nadu Chief Minister C. Joseph Vijay inaugurated the MLA office in his Perambur constituency on July 13, 2026. He also distributed smart ration cards and launched an e-service centre during the visit.

Chief Minister C. Joseph Vijay, president of TVK, visited Perambur for the first time in an official capacity two months after the 2026 Assembly election results. He inaugurated the renovated MLA office at Sharma Nagar and paid respects to the party’s ideological leaders. Several ministers including Aadhav Arjuna and K.A. Sengottaiyan were present.

Vijay issued certificates, inaugurated the e-Sevai centre and launched a website and mobile app for residents to report grievances. He later distributed smart family cards at a nearby ration shop and inspected the Metropolitan Transport Corporation’s electric bus depot at Vyasarpadi.

The state government plans to implement 50 civic infrastructure projects worth ₹1,013 crore in Perambur over the next two years. Vijay also approved seven projects under the MLA Local Area Development Scheme, including a sports facility and a dialysis centre. Chennai Corporation Commissioner G.S. Sameeran said the Chief Minister had sanctioned ₹3 crore immediately for these projects.
